    Why Local News Matters

    Okay, so you might be thinking, "Why should I care about local news when there's so much happening in the world?" Great question! Local news is super important because it directly affects your day-to-day life. Think about it: national and international news can feel distant, but local news? That’s about your community. It's about the streets you drive on, the schools your kids attend, and the local economy that impacts your job.

    Local news keeps you informed about:

    • Local government: Ever wonder where your tax dollars are going? Local news covers city council meetings, school board decisions, and other government actions that directly impact your wallet and your community. Staying informed helps you hold your elected officials accountable.
    • Community events: From farmers' markets to festivals, local news keeps you in the loop about what's happening around town. It's a great way to discover new things to do and connect with your neighbors.
    • Public safety: Breaking news about crime, fires, and other emergencies is crucial for keeping you and your family safe. Local news provides timely updates and information on how to protect yourself.
    • Education: School board meetings, changes in curriculum, and local school events all fall under the purview of local news. If you have kids in school (or even if you don't!), this is important information to stay on top of.
    • Local economy: New businesses opening, job opportunities, and economic development projects are all covered by local news. This helps you understand the economic landscape of your community.

    In short, local news is your window into what's happening right here, right now. It empowers you to be an informed and engaged citizen.

    Other Ways to Stay Informed in Tulsa

    While News On 6 is a great resource, it's always a good idea to get your news from multiple sources. Here are a few other ways to stay informed about what's happening in Tulsa:

    • Tulsa World: This is Tulsa's local newspaper. They offer in-depth coverage of local news, sports, and business. You can subscribe to the print edition or access their content online.
    • Public Radio Tulsa: NPR affiliate KWGS 89.5 FM provides local and national news, as well as cultural programming. It's a great way to stay informed while you're on the go.
    • The Black Wall Street Times: This publication focuses on news and issues affecting the Black community in Tulsa. It's an important voice in the local media landscape.
    • Local blogs and community websites: There are many local blogs and community websites that cover specific topics of interest, such as food, music, and arts. These can be great resources for finding out about niche events and activities.
